Embrace the Power of Planning and Scheduling

One of the most effective strategies for soccer mom organizers is to develop a strong planning and scheduling system. A well-structured schedule can reduce the stress of daily tasks, improve productivity, and allow for better time allocation. Start by identifying key responsibilities—such as work hours, school drop-offs and pickups, family meals, and personal time—and map them out on a weekly or monthly calendar.

Utilizing digital tools such as Google Calendar, Apple Calendar, or even simple apps like Trello can help maintain a clear overview of upcoming events and deadlines. Setting reminders for important tasks ensures that nothing falls through the cracks. For instance, a soccer mom might use a shared family calendar to keep all household members informed of important dates and events. This not only fosters transparency but also helps reduce misunderstandings and conflicts that can arise from miscommunication.

Streamline Communication with Family and Friends

Clear and consistent communication is essential for any soccer mom organizer. When multiple people are involved in managing a household and coordinating children’s activities, miscommunication can lead to confusion, missed events, and unnecessary stress. Establishing open lines of communication with family members, other parents, and coaches can make a significant difference in managing responsibilities effectively.

Consider implementing a shared communication platform such as WhatsApp, Slack, or even a group email list. These tools allow for real-time updates, quick decision-making, and efficient information sharing. For example, if a soccer practice is rescheduled, a group message can instantly inform all parents involved, minimizing the risk of someone missing the event. Additionally, setting up a family meeting once a week can be an excellent opportunity to review upcoming events, discuss concerns, and realign priorities.

Create a System for Managing Household Tasks

Household management is a cornerstone of being an effective soccer mom organizer. Between cleaning, cooking, laundry, and meal planning, it’s easy to feel overwhelmed. Developing a system that assigns responsibilities, sets clear expectations, and promotes accountability can lead to a more organized and stress-free home environment.

One practical approach is to create a household task chart that outlines daily and weekly chores. This chart can be posted in a common area of the home, allowing all family members to see their responsibilities. Involving children in household tasks not only lightens the load but also teaches them the value of contributing to the family unit. For instance, a soccer mom might assign her children specific chores such as setting the table, tidying their rooms, or helping with the dishes. This fosters a sense of responsibility and teamwork within the family.

Prioritize Self-Care and Mental Well-Being

While managing a busy schedule as a soccer mom organizer, it's essential not to neglect self-care and mental well-being. The demands of juggling work, family, and social responsibilities can be exhausting, and without proper self-care, burnout is inevitable. Prioritizing mental health is not a luxury—it’s a necessity for maintaining long-term productivity and happiness.

One practical strategy is to set aside dedicated time for self-care, whether it's a few minutes each day for meditation, a weekly yoga session, or simply taking a short walk. These small moments of respite can help reduce stress and improve focus. Additionally, seeking support from friends, family, or professional counselors can be a powerful tool in maintaining emotional well-being. A soccer mom might, for example, join a local support group for parents or engage in online communities where they can share experiences and receive encouragement from others in similar situations.

Leverage Technology for Efficiency and Organization

In today’s digital age, technology offers a wide range of tools that can help soccer moms streamline their daily tasks and reduce the burden of manual organization. From mobile apps to smart home devices, the right technology can make a significant difference in managing time, tasks, and family life more efficiently.

Consider using apps such as Cozi, MyLifeOrganized, or Evernote to keep track of grocery lists, bills, and important reminders. These apps can sync across multiple devices, allowing for seamless access and updates from anywhere. Smart home devices such as voice-activated assistants can also help with setting reminders, managing schedules, and even controlling home automation systems. For instance, a soccer mom might use a smart speaker to set reminders for upcoming events or to play calming music while preparing dinner, thereby reducing stress and improving overall efficiency.
